The Unframed Arts Collective is a group of students (now recent graduates) that witnessed firsthand the difficulties related to housing insecurity and came together to design a program devoted to serving New Yorkers experiencing financial hardships. The Unframed Arts Collective started at a soup kitchen with two tables devoted to delivering art therapy and conversation to our guests and have increased to a space with 6 tables devoted to providing a variety of resources and services to individuals in need.
Our guests are a population that undoubtedly remains underserved in our current social, political, and economic climate. They navigate their day-to-day feeling unheard by the world. Every Sunday, we make it our mission to ensure our guests feel heard, acknowledged, seen, and respected. The arts are meant to mitigate these inequalities by uplifting their expression and healing. In its various forms, the arts are a method of storytelling that demands the artist's story, heart, and soul be heard, known, and remembered.
The Unframed Arts Collective started with just two workshop tables centered through the arts designed to offer spaces of self-expression, conversation, and peace in a form of art therapy. We have had guests who shared that they have never picked up a paint brush and it has truly been an honor to encourage and witness the evolution of their artistic development. On the other hand, we have also had guests with visual arts and literary backgrounds and a strong vision for their work that we have the privilege to support.
From that point, our programs have grown as we’ve considered how else we can serve the community. We now offer a free book library, take-home art activities for kids, and school supplies for all ages. In progress is the addition of writing workshops, the creation of a community post board that can be a resource for our guests, schoolwork support, and a summer art gallery, as well as the opportunity for tabling for different community-based organizations that can use our space.
For our younger and immigrant guests, art becomes a medium that welcomes them to an ecosystem of inclusion. Art communicates happiness, but also grief and loss, becoming a long-term coping resource and support system. The Unframed Arts Collective's goal is to not only provide a space to foster community but also to platform an underserved community and raise awareness on the effects of the currently progressing homelessness crisis.
